Abstract

Official abstract text for this publication.

RNA interference using small interfering RNAs which are specific for the vascular endothelial growth factor (VEGF) gene and the VEGF receptor genes Flt-1 and Flk-1/KDR inhibit expression of these genes. Diseases which involve angiogenesis stimulated by overexpression of VEGF, such as diabetic retinopathy, age related macular degeneration and many types of cancer, can be treated by administering the small interfering RNAs.

First claim

Opening claim text (preview).

We claim: 1. An isolated dsRNA consisting of a 19 to 25 nucleotide sense RNA strand and a 19 to 25 nucleotide antisense RNA strand, wherein the sense and the antisense RNA strands form an RNA duplex, and wherein the antisense RNA strand consists of a nucleotide sequence that hybridizes to SEQ ID NOs: 20 or 52. 2. The dsRNA of claim 1 , wherein the antisense RNA strand consists of a nucleotide sequence that hybridizes to SEQ ID NOs: 20 and 52.…
